Having stayed at Tokyo Dome, this hotel compares poorly to its swankier neighbour. The room we had was very small, with an even smaller toilet, and hardly space for luggage. It is clean and it had a small TV, a hairdryer and a small kettle. Sufficient, but good only for one night. ||||Although I appreciated the breakfast that came with the room booking, I did not enjoy the breakfast as the quality was rather poor at a small Chinese restaurant in the basement of the hotel.||||There is a nice garden next to the hotel, good for a nice stroll in the park. Location is not bad, but head towards the Dome if you want restaurants and activities when it gets dark.

Location was very good, in a quiet resident area, close to Iidabashi subway station, Tokyo Dome. Room was small, not enough space to unpack my bags. Everything in the room was simple but well arranged. Bathroom was small too and a bit outdated. Staff was friendly but could not speak English very well. WiFi was free but a bit slow.
